https://www.hkstack.com/ 德讯电讯提供

香港服务器租用台湾服务器租用美国服务器租用日本服务器租用高防服务器租用CDN节点

联系Telegram:@wwwdxcomtw   

优化MATLAB绘图线宽设置的技巧与应用实例

在MATLAB中调整plot函数的线宽

优化MATLAB绘图线宽设置的技巧与应用实例

在进行数据可视化时,线宽的设置是一个不可忽视的细节,能够显著影响图形的可读性和美观性。本文将指导您如何使用MATLAB中的plot函数来设置和调整线宽,以便使您的图形表现更加突出。

操作前的准备

确保您已安装并能够运行MATLAB。理解基本的图形绘制概念以及如何使用plot函数将帮助您更顺利地完成以下步骤。

详细操作步骤

步骤1:创建基础数据

首先,我们需要准备一些数据来进行绘图。下面的代码将创建一个简单的正弦波和余弦波数据集。

x = 0:0.1:10; % 数据范围,从0到10,步长为0.1

y1 = sin(x); % 正弦波数据

y2 = cos(x); % 余弦波数据

步骤2:使用plot函数绘制数据

接下来,我们使用plot函数来绘制这两条曲线,默认线宽为0.5。

figure; % 创建新的图形窗口

plot(x, y1); % 绘制正弦波

hold on; % 保持当前图形

plot(x, y2); % 绘制余弦波

hold off; % 释放图形

步骤3:设置线宽

我们可以通过‘LineWidth’属性来设置线宽。在下面的代码中,我们将线宽设置为2。

figure; % 创建新的图形窗口

plot(x, y1, 'LineWidth', 2); % 绘制正弦波,线宽为2

hold on; % 保持当前图形

plot(x, y2, 'LineWidth', 2); % 绘制余弦波,线宽为2

hold off; % 释放图形

legend('sin(x)', 'cos(x)'); % 添加图例

title('正弦和余弦波'); % 添加标题

xlabel('x 轴'); % x 轴标签

ylabel('y 轴'); % y 轴标签

重要概念解释

LineWidth属性用于设置曲线的线宽。默认值为0.5,可以根据需要调整为更大的数值,以增强可视效果。线宽的数值越大,线条显得越粗。通常,2到4的范围为常用值。

可能遇到的问题及注意事项

  • 图形重叠:使用hold on时,要确保在操作完成后使用hold off释放图形,防止后续绘图混淆。
  • 颜色和线型:在选择线宽时,建议同时考虑线型和颜色,以保证最终图形的对比度和清晰度。
  • 打印和发布:如果您计划将图形打印或发布,确保线宽足够以便在各种设备上保持可读性。

实用技巧

如果您需要对多条曲线进行不同的线宽设置,可以在调用plot函数时为每条曲线分别设置。例如:

plot(x, y1, 'LineWidth', 2); % 正弦波线宽为2

plot(x, y2, 'LineWidth', 4); % 余弦波线宽为4

此外,可以将所有的设置整合到一个函数中,以实现快速重用。

总结

本文介绍了如何在MATLAB中使用plot函数设置线宽。通过调整线宽,您可以有效提升数据可视化的效果和清晰度。现在,您可以运用这些技巧去制作更专业的图形。请尽情发挥您的创造力!